Subject: DR drill tonight — catalogue import

On-call: Hollowmere catalogue import fails over to the standby cluster at 02:00. Expect alerts from Stackbinder; ack but don't page further. Validate row counts after cutover, then resume the ingest queue. If the standby's sealed config store prompts you, enter the recovery passphrase given below.

recovery phrase for fawif-tajeg: norael-aldmir-casir-brivan-ulaion

Meeting notes — Velmora Holdings property transfer. The notarised deed for the Arden Hollow parcel was signed and sealed this morning at the Quillford notary office. Receiving site at Marwick House should expect the original document by courier before noon Thursday. Copies remain with counsel. The hand-over instruction for the courier is as follows:

dispatch memo: the lamwyn fenwyn courier leaves the wenir ledger at gate 7175 under passcode 822969

Handover — Vexler partner SFTP drop

Ownership moves to you today. Drop runs hourly from Vexler's end into the intake bucket via the relay host. Watch for zero-byte files; their exporter flakes on Mondays. Creds live in the ops vault, path noted in the runbook. Vault auto-seals after 48h idle. Support escalations go to the on-call rotation, not me. If the vault is sealed when you need it, unseal with the recovery passphrase below.

recovery phrase for tadug-fafof: zorwyn-kasion

## Changelog — Tidemark Widget 3.2

Defaults changed. Read before touching anything.

- Refresh interval now hourly, not every 15 min. Harbor feeds from the Pellisport aggregator throttle aggressive polling.
- Lunar-offset correction is on by default. Disable only for legacy Kestrel Bay deployments.
- Chart units default to metric. The imperial fallback flag is deprecated and will be removed in 3.4.
- Cache eviction is now time-based, not size-based.

New installs should start from the default configuration values listed below.

config for kahap-taweg:
oliox:
  pin: 8609
  tenant: casath
  seal: seal_632a4a6f
  metrics_host: metrics.oliox.nelvrogrid.example
  standby_team: keleth
  escalation: briiel-oliwyn
  nonce: e2397c